Pine Timber

All our handmade furniture is made from solid pine timber and this natural material with knots and it does expand and contrast in different temperatures. Wood is hygroscopic, which means its MC will fluctuate based on the relative humidity (RH) of the surrounding air. As humidity increases, the MC increases, and the wood expands, and as the humidity decreases, MC decreases, and the wood shrinks. Unfortunately this can not be stopped on a natural material but it is an easy fix as the actual build is not effected. If you have a knot appear or open up this can be fixed and if your have movement on the door panels or backboards again this is an easy fix.

Flush Hinges

We use high quality UK manufactured flush hinges that are produced for Cheshire Pine. We do not use inferior quality products from DIY stores that are imported in bulk and cost effective. We also do not use kitchen types hinges that are typically used when a wooden kitchen door is combined with melamine.

Our furntiure is built with a frame following traditional methods and the doors are not mounted on the outside but fitted into the frame.

We have 3 colours of our hinges. SILVER, FLORENTINE BRONZE and BRASS.

We choose the hinge colour that best goes with the colour of the paint choice, or the contrast knobs or the colour of your own knobs/handles. Our hinges are 50 mm FLUSH HINGES and are manufactured specially for us. We are unable to use any other hinges or the ones that you may want to buy and for us to use. Please accept our apologies that this is not possible. We guarantee our doors with the hinges that have been design and manufactured in the UK for ourselves. The way that the doors are hung and the thickness of the timber means our hinges work.

Double Roller Catches for closing doors

All our doors are closed shut with the strong traditional UK manufactured double roller catches. We do not use modern magnetic catches or any slow closing mechanisms. Magnetic catches are typically used on modern furniture that is combined with melamine, MDF, plywood and man made boards. 

We do not use any fitted kitchen type hardware and we use traditional fittings. Our furniture is built to last and this is why we continue to use the traditional cabinet making methods.

How We Manufacture

All our furniture is made using solid timber - no MDF, plywood or man made boards are used, even when painted. We use a Kreg® Pocket-Hole Machine to construct cabinets furniture, bookshelves, tables etc with multiple joints in a professional way. It drills a pilot hole and counterbore at a 15-degree angle into the timber without the use of glue, nails and screws on the outside what can be on view, look very unsightly and not as strong. It enables us to construct furniture from the inside instead of the outside. Our time served cabinet makers have used this for many many years in our manufacturing and it gives the best strength and most stable construction out there. These pilot holes are visible on the inside side edge.
